About Horsemanship

Natural Horsemanship requires the human to be knowledgable of the horse's natural instincts and a communication system to use this knowledge in their work with the horse.

 

There is an emphasis on timing, feel and consistency from the trainer.

 

Humans can learn to use their body language to communicate with the horse in a similar way that horse's do to each-other.

 

The objective is for the horse to be calm and feel safe thoughout the training process.

A horse that feels calm and safe with his handler is quick to bond with that person.

 

The results can be remarkable.
